Gurukul students to pursue research in IITs with scholarships up to Rs 2 lakh

The Ministry of Education, in collaboration with the Indian Knowledge Systems (IKS) division at Central Sanskrit University, has introduced the Setubandha Scholarship Scheme -- a major initiative to support Gurukul-educated students in transitioning into formal postgraduate and doctoral research in top institutions like the Indian Institutes of Technology (IITs).The initiative offers monthly scholarships and academic mentorship, and is considered a major step in mainstreaming Indian Knowledge Systems (IKS).advertisementUP TO RS 2 LAKH SCHOLARSHIPS FOR IKS SCHOLARSSelected scholars will receive monthly scholarships starting from Rs 40,000, with postgraduate students eligible for up to Rs 1 lakh and PhD candidates for up to Rs 2 lakh.'This scheme will serve as a bridge between the ancient Gurukul tradition and modern research,' said Professor Srinivasa Varkhedi, Vice-Chancellor of Central Sanskrit University. 'It will provide recognition to traditional scholars and unlock new paths for academic innovation.'ELIGIBILITY AND DEADLINE Applicants must be under 32 years of age, with a minimum of five years of study under a traditional Guru or Gurukul system. No formal degree is required, but candidates must demonstrate proven excellence in classical knowledge. The application deadline is August DISCIPLINES UNDER SETUBANDHA SCHEMEScholars can pursue research across 18 Indian Knowledge Systems-aligned disciplines, as listed below:Anvikshiki Vidya – Vedic philosophy and cognitive scienceLanguage and Vak Analysis – Linguistics and grammarHistory and Civilization Studies – Indian history and cultureDharmashastra and Secular Law – Religion, society and lawPolitics and Economics – Political and strategic studiesMathematics, Physics and Jyotisha – Maths, physics and astrologyMedicine and Health Science – Ayurveda and health sciencesSubstance, Quality and Combination Science – Chemistry, medicine and nutritionAgriculture and Animal Husbandry – Traditional agricultural practicesArchitecture and Construction Science – Vastu and engineeringRasa-Metal Science – Chemistry and metallurgyMechanical and New Engineering – Mechanics and digital engineeringGandharva Vidya – Theatre, music and performing artsSculpture and Visual Arts – Fine arts and iconographyOrnamental and Decorative Arts – Fashion and interior designEducational and Recreational Studies – Education and entertainmentVeda-Vedanga and Philosophy – Vedas and Indian philosophyDandaniti Vidya – Governance and jurisprudenceREVIVING INDIA 'S ANCIENT KNOWLEDGE SYSTEMSProfessor Varkhedi called the initiative 'a historic effort to restore India's ancient knowledge systems to the global research arena.'Scholars will benefit from access to cutting-edge labs and mentorship at institutes like IITs, bridging gaps between traditional wisdom and scientific enquiry.- Ends
